Event Description
Join Larkin Greene from Vettec & Jon Johnson, CJF for the Jon Johnson Modern Materials Clinic. This hands-on event will teach tricks and tips about casting, glue-ons, and everything in between.
Hands-on availability is limited. Space is unlimited for auditors. Payment for clinic is due at sign-up and will guarantee a spot.
$175.00 for 2 days. $100.00 for 1 day. $40.00 to audit (non member). WSFA members may audit at no charge.
